#b87950 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b87950 is composed of 72.2% red, 47.5%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.2% magenta, 56.5%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 23.7 degrees, a saturation of 42.3% and a lightness of 51.8%. #b87950 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ff2a0 with #710000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#b87950 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b87950 has RGB values of R:184, G:121,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.57,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 12089680.

Shades and Tints of #b87950
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060403 is the darkest color, while #fcf9f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b87950
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#89837f is the less saturated color, while #fa6b0e is the most saturated one.
